Job Description

Entry Level Technician Thomas Chrysler Dodge Jeep Ram of Highland 9604 Indianapolis Boulevard, Highland, IN 46322 Full-time Full-time If you are LOVE cars & are wanting to get into a dealership with the purpose of learning and growing into a highly skilled technician, then this is the opening for YOU! This job description outlines an entry-level technician position at Thomas Dodge Chrysler Jeep of Highland, located in Highland, Indiana. The role primarily involves performing basic automotive inspections, general maintenance & repairs, such as oil changes, tire rotations, brake inspections, using diagnostic equipment, new vehicle preps & more. The technician will also communicate with service advisors and customers, explaining necessary repairs and providing estimates, while adhering to manufacturer standards and safety protocols.
Compensation & Benefits:
Hourly pay range is based on experience Paid Factory Training.
Comprehensive benefits package:
medical, dental, and vision insurance, paid time off, and growth opportunities within the company. Amazing 401k retirement plan.
Responsibilities:
Conduct basic automotive inspections, general maintenance & repairs Collaborate with service advisors and customers to explain repairs and provide estimates. Work according to manufacturer specifications and safety standards. Maintain a clean, organized work environment and continue learning about new automotive technologies.
Requirements:
High school diploma or equivalent. Prior automotive education is an advantage. Previous automotive experience is preferred but not required. Strong mechanical aptitude and problem-solving skills. Energetic, self-motivated, and eager to learn. Excellent communication and customer service skills. Must have reliable transportation. Basic tools to perform light vehicle maintenance. Valid driver's license with a clean driving record. Must pass a background check and drug screening.
